I am...

The nap of my hair
The fall of my breasts
The dark of my skin
I am black
The poetry in my veins
The spirit that doesn't break
The fairness that sneaks in
I am dark
I am woman I am total but not one
I am searching for the one
I am crisis
Loud yet silent
Mistreated yet trusting
Mother to bastard baby
I am loud and tired
I am fighting
Called ugly
I am fragile and strong
Held loosely in pigs hand
I am brazen
Thoughtless
Thoughtful even
I am unloved
I am searching for the one
I am queen
I am queer
I am queen
The thickness of my lips
The brightening of my hips
The darkness of my eyes
It's all there
I am total in one
I am black
I am dark I am woman
I am the one
